Arlo Technologies (NYSE:ARLO) Releases Quarterly Earnings Results, Beats Estimates By $0.08 EPS

Arlo Technologies (NYSE:ARLOGet Free Report) iss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day. The company reported $0.28 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.20 by $0.08, FiscalAI reports. The business had revenue of $155.94 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$148.94 million. Arlo Technologies had a return on equity of 17.90% and a net margin of 5.20%.Arlo Technologies’s quarterly revenue was up 20.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$0.17 EPS. Arlo Technologies updated its FY 2026 guidance to 0.900-1.000 EPS and its Q3 2026 guidance to 0.170-0.230 EPS.

Here are the key takeaways from Arlo Technologies’ conference call:

  • Q2 results set records, with total revenue of $155.9 million, up 21% year over year, service revenue of $93 million, adjusted EBITDA up 70% to $30.6 million, and non-GAAP EPS of $0.28.
  • Paid accounts increased by nearly 300,000 to 6.3 million, while improving ARPU, lower churn, stronger renewals, and a 15% rise in account lifetime value to $967 supported subscription momentum.
  • Arlo significantly raised its 2026 outlook to $580 million–$600 million in revenue and $0.90–$1.00 in non-GAAP EPS; management also expects Secure 7, a higher-priced subscription tier, and partnerships with ADT and Comcast to support future growth.
  • Product gross margin remains structurally negative, at roughly negative mid- to high-single digits or potentially the teens, as Arlo uses hardware promotions to acquire subscribers; Q2 profitability also benefited from an $8 million tariff refund and Q3 is expected to receive another roughly $6 million refund.
  • Management plans additional share repurchases after buying back more than $20 million of stock in Q2, while Aloe Care’s Home Helpers deployment and planned care and small-business market tests could create new growth opportunities in 2027.

Arlo Technologies Stock Down 1.7%

Shares of ARLO traded down $0.26 during mid-day trading on Friday, hitting $15.21. 2,594,257 shares of the company’s st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 1,050,835. The firm has a market cap of $1.65 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 56.35 and a beta of 1.56. Arlo Technologies has a 52 week low of $11.05 and a 52 week high of $19.94. The stock’s 50-day simple moving average is $13.38 and its 200-day simple moving average is $13.47.

Insider Activity

In related news, CFO Kurtis Joseph Binder sold 27,297 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ction on Tuesday, August 4th. The stock was sold at an average price of $15.52, for a total value of $423,649.44. Following the transaction, the chief financial officer owned 442,110 shares in the company, valued at approximately $6,861,547.20. This trade represents a 5.82%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through this link.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. Over the last quarter, insiders sold 57,775 shares of company stock worth $845,139. Corporate insiders own 2.90% of the company’s stock.

About Arlo Technologies

Arlo Technologies, Inc (NYSE: ARLO) is a provider of smart home security products and services designed for residential and small business customers. The company offers a portfolio of wireless and Wi-Fi-enabled security cameras, video doorbells, smart lighting solutions, and associated accessories. Arlo integrates advanced video analytics, motion detection, cloud storage, and two-way audio capabilities to deliver end-to-end security and monitoring solutions accessible through mobile applications and web interfaces.

Founded as a division of Netgear, Inc in 2014 and spun off as an independent public company in 2018, Arlo Technologies has established a presence in North America, Europe, Australia and parts of Asia.
